When we
are calling, we find fresh sign and we are the bait. Black bears respond
well to calling and our methods produce some exciting hunts. We call for
everything we hunt. Predator calling is probably the fastest growing
type of hunting in North America. Calling bears fits right in. Whether
you want to hunt with a bow, rifle or camera, we can call them in.
The
areas we call have some large bears and about 30% color phase. The
numbers are good and each hunter is allowed 2 bears.
We
hunt bears in spring or fall. Fall hunts can be combined with moose.
